WordOmni is an AI-powered word unscrambling tool founded on the Gold Coast, Queensland, Australia. It is designed to help players of word games such as Scrabble and Wordle solve anagrams instantly. The platform positions itself as the fastest and most accurate solution in its category, offering expert guides and trending scrambles. It operates in the SaaS and Media & Entertainment categories, targeting word game enthusiasts who require quick, verified results.
